Overcoming T cell tolerance to tumor self-antigens through catch-bond engineering T cells are often weakly responsive to tumor self-antigens because of central tolerance, constraining their ability to eliminate tumors. We exploited mechanical force to engineer a weakly reactive T c...

Preview
Pro-inflammatory macrophages produce mitochondria-derived superoxide by reverse electron transport at complex I that regulates IL-1β release during NLRP3 inflammasome activation - Nature Metabolism Casey et al. explore the basic mechanisms of mitochondrial superoxide production and its impact on interleukin-1β production in LPS-treated macrophages.

More evidence accumulates that pyroptosis is regulated by ROS after GSDMD cleavage occurs. A beautiful mechanistic study on mitochondrial ROS acting downstream of NLRP3 activation.
